- The distance between Little Rock, Arkansas, Usa and Gloversville, Ny, Usa is approximately 1,798 km or 1,117 mi.
- To reach Little Rock, Arkansas in this distance one would set out from Gloversville, Ny bearing 245°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Little Rock, Arkansas bearing 233.7° or SW .
- Little Rock, Arkansas has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Gloversville, Ny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Little Rock, Arkansas is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Gloversville, Ny is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 9.4 °C (16.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.6 °C (8.3°F) less in Little Rock, Arkansas.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 214.7 mm (8.5 in) more which is equivalent to 214.7 l/m² (5.27 US gal/ft²) or 2,147,000 l/ha (229,529 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.3° higher in Little Rock, Arkansas than in Gloversville, Ny.
